Output 12c8a6175742cf09703c742bb9d241f05f1fefd12fe6c122ef5c44ec64eff876:3

value
959049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2926ad45b9968a77eee2534bfd3b2ca866d6936 OP_EQUAL
address
3HyDbwbY8o3tcwUJYz986yqXcxbtdvqoGh
transaction
12c8a6175742cf09703c742bb9d241f05f1fefd12fe6c122ef5c44ec64eff876
spent
true